Step-by-step explanation:
volume of a cone =
πr²h
π = 3.14
r = radius ]
h = height
the base of a cone is in the shape of a circle. thus, the circumference of the base is equal to the circumference of a circle
circumference of a circle= 2πr
30.144 = 2 x 3.14 x r
r = 30.144 / 6.28
r = 4.8
Volume = 1/3 x 3.14 x 4.8² x 8 = 192.92 ft^3

Step-by-step explanation:
1 week costs $11.50.
so, how many such weekly each cycles fit into the price of new machines ?
if they wait to long (to many weeks) they spend in total more money than buying a new machine.
but if they stay still below that max. number of weeks, they have at least the illusion that they are cheaper of with the weekly laundromat investment (but they forget, sooner or later they will need the new machines).
so the break even point is simply
782 / 11.5 = 68 weeks.
after 68 weeks it has cost them exactly the same amount of money, as if they had bought new machines right away at the beginning.
